One of the best. Classic trad climb with it all. Boulder problem start, squeeze chimney, long crack, and steep corner crux. Linked the pitches. Halfway belay ledge has plenty of decent gear for the belay right underneath the crux corner. Witnessed my brother charge up the crux ignoring the critical rest jug (cough, right, cough cough).

don't be discouraged by some of the comments below. It is a pretty good and very safe climb with reasonable rock quality and good gear. It's best to belay on the ledge above the bird poo as the description suggest - plenty of gear options. Grade wise the crux moves are consistent with other Bluyes trad 17s with rest of the climb being easier, just don't approach it with a 'sport grade 17 leader' mindset. Watch rope drag if combining last two pitches.

P1-P2 John Shaw led both onsight
P1 Hard start then up to an awkward chimney to some fine climbing.
P2 Gread pitch, shame its not longer. P3 (CRUX) My lead. Awesome bit of rock, well protected with small nuts and cams, stemming problems up the overhanging corner. Highly recommended P4 John onsite lead, easy finish out of cave |
